What can I see and do near Huixian Hall?
You'll want to browse the collections at Guo Moruo Memorial, Antiquarium of The Palace Museum and National Art Museum of China. Sights like Prince Gong Mansion, Shichahai and Bell and Drum Towers are landmarks to visit in the area. You can watch performances at Beijing Capital Theatre, Great Hall of the People and National Centre for the Performing Arts if you're interested in local theatre.
How can I get to Huixian Hall?
With so many choices for transport, seeing all of the area near Huixian Hall is easy. You can access metro transport at Jinyu Hutong Station, Dengshikou Station and Wangfujing Station. If you want to explore the larger area, hop aboard a train at Beijing Railway Station.
